HARARE, Zimbabwe — Five Americans who worked with AIDS orphans and patients in Zimbabwe have been arrested in the southern African country and accused of operating without proper medical licenses, their lawyer said Saturday.
Attorney Jonathan Samukange identified one as Gloria Cox Crowell, chairwoman of an AIDS program run by the Allen Temple Baptist Church in Oakland, Calif.
Samukange said Cox Crowell and the four other Americans were arrested late Friday along with a Zimbabwean doctor. A court appearance is expected Monday.
